I try to flank as much as possible when needed and I don't mind doing it, what I find happens in matches a lot that I dislike is:
"Okay guys I got this area, they're all in a line I'll snipe as many as I can, someone cover my flank and you guys go down there and attack them from the rea- or you could all just jump down and wade into their midst... okay then, well I'll just take this shot and go round and do the flanking- oh look you Biotic Charged that guy a split second before my shot went off and it missed... and you didn't even kill him- and now they've swarmed you, and now you're all dead from the crossfire and now they're all dispersed in cover and refusing to pop out and OH GOD some new enemies are coming up behind me, Tactical Cloak bang bang bang thank god those are two are gone... OH GOD THEY'RE COMING UP THE LADDER! BANG BANG! Too many, I have to fall back to- OH GOD WHY ARE THERE GUARDIANS HERE!?"
And no matter how you Archangel it up, when there's a swarm that makes the Zerg look like a stray ant you're probably not going to make it through.
After several games of that I make it my business to flank or cover the rear even when I'm much better suited to sniping.
In my eyes Snipers ( and I don't just mean people who use Sniper Rifles) have three critical duties
-Stop enemies from getting close or open them up so squadmates in the thick can kill them (this is somewhat reliant on your squadmates letting you open them up first though :\\ )
-Watch and guard vantage points, that means providing a 'safe zone' and guarding all exits in and around it.
-Getting the multiple data packets that are away from your squad who are in the thick of things
I say all this probably sounding like I think I'm a good player, I'm not, sometimes I downright suck but I like to think that me thinking about these things and trying is somewhat redeeming.
Finally, anyone who thinks their kill percentage is > than helping the team and winning the match is an idiot, plain and simple. It's been my experience that the rewards for winning a match far exceed the potential winnings you get from maximizing your selfish potential but losing the match. Anyway if you DO contribute to the team then you should be getting plenty of kills or at least a plethora of assists anyway.
